Annual data
| Year | Income TaxValue | YoY GrowthYoY |
|---|---|---|
| FY2025 | $6.2M | +430.0% |
| FY2024 | -$1.9M | -176.3% |
| FY2023 | $2.5M | -73.2% |
| FY2022 | $9.2M | -16.6% |
| FY2021 | $11.0M | +19.9% |
| FY2020 | $9.2M | -84.1% |
| FY2019 | $57.5M | +252.1% |
| FY2018 | $16.3M | -71.6% |
| FY2017 | $57.5M | +279.4% |
| FY2016 | $15.2M | +609.4% |
